    <> "What was the final outcome of the Battle of Peleliu.

    The Battle of Peleliu Island is actually the most tragic battle in the Pacific Theater, the consumption of time, the largest amount, the material consumption is serious is an unprecedented level, the ammunition consumed by the U.S. Army on the island is actually far more than Iwo Jima, and the personnel are also very serious, only to October 12, 1944, the U.S. Army announced that the end of the battle on Peleliu Island, the 1st Marine Division of the U.S. Marine Corps has more than 10,000 people, including 1,950 killed and 8,500 wounded, and the proportion of the division's total strength reaches 60%, By the time the U.S. military announced that on November 27, 1944, the U.S. military had officially announced the complete occupation of Perry Iwo Island, together with the 81st Division and other troops, the total number of U.S. troops was nearly 13,000, and together with the battle on Unger Island (the Japanese army on the island was an infantry brigade of 900 men and more than 700 Korean migrant workers), the entire Palau battle was believed to have a total U.S. ground strength of nearly 15,000 people.

    Less than 200 of the Japanese garrison on Peleliu Island, including soldiers disarmed in 1947, survived. In terms of ammunition consumption, the U.S. Rapid Hail Army consumed 2,200 U.S. tons of ammunition for the infantry of the 1st Marine Division alone before 27 November, and the U.S. troops consumed more than 40,000 tons of ammunition before and after, while the Japanese army had half of the battle (five bases of various ammunition). This battle also allowed the U.S. military to see the horror of the real elite troops of the Japanese army, and it was based on this consideration, coupled with the subsequent Battle of Iwo Jima, that the U.S. military made the decision to skip Taiwan and attack Okinawa directly.

    The controversy at the Battle of Peleliu was whether it had sufficient strategic value. The island's airfield was largely useless during the U.S. attack on the Philippines, and the island was not used as a staging ground later. To the north of Palau is the Caroline Islands, one of which is the Ulithi Atoll, which was used as a springboard for attacks on Okinawa.

    In addition, due to the prophecy of Rupetus's "four-day occupation", only six reporters came to the battlefield to report on the army, and as a result, there was very little news about it.

    In the shadow of the big news of MacArthur's recapture of the Philippines and the Allied invasion of Germany, the Battle of Peleliu became obscure. Some say that the most useful aspect of this battle was that it allowed the American military to accumulate some experience in how to effectively capture composite fortifications and heavily defended Japanese-occupied islands.

    The Japanese army gave full play to this composite fortification defense tactic in the battles of Iwo Jima and Okinawa, and inflicted a heavy blow on the US army in the Pacific War.

    At the suggestion of Admiral Halsey, the U.S. military finally abandoned the capture of Yap Island in the Palau archipelago. In fact, Halsey's proposal was to cancel the landing on Peleliu and Aur and capture Leyte instead. But Halsey's suggestion was rejected by Admiral Nimitz.
